Unique Advantages of Handmade Carpets
One of the defining features of
handmade carpets is their unparalleled craftsmanship. Unlike machine-made
carpets, each handmade piece is woven by skilled artisans who bring decades of
experience and tradition into every knot. This level of artisanal detail
results in carpets that are not only visually stunning but also structurally
strong.
Handmade carpets are known for their
longevity and can last for generations with proper care. Their natural
fibers—often wool, silk, jute, or cotton—provide a soft, comfortable feel
underfoot. These materials are also known for their insulating properties,
helping maintain warmth in cooler months while offering breathability during
warmer seasons.
Another major advantage is the
uniqueness of each piece. No two handmade carpets are exactly the same. Their
natural variations add personality and charm to any space, making them ideal
for homeowners, designers, and collectors who appreciate originality.

Maintenance
Tips for Long-Lasting Beauty
While handmade carpets are durable,
proper care ensures they remain vibrant and strong for decades. Routine
maintenance begins with regular vacuuming to prevent dust and debris from
settling deep into the fibers. Use a vacuum without a beater bar to avoid
unnecessary pulling or stress on the weave.
Rotating your carpet every few
months helps ensure even wear, especially in high-traffic areas. Placing rug
pads underneath prevents slippage, adds cushioning, and protects the carpet
from friction against flooring.
For spills and stains, quick action
is essential. Blot—never rub—the affected area with a clean cloth to absorb as
much liquid as possible. Use mild soap or carpet-safe cleaning solutions, but
avoid harsh chemicals that may damage the fibers or cause discoloration. For
deep cleaning, professional carpet washing services are recommended, especially
for delicate materials like silk.
Protect your handmade carpets from
prolonged exposure to direct sunlight, which may cause fading. If your carpet
is placed near windows, consider using curtains or blinds during peak daylight
hours.
